All rights reserved. * Modification copyright (C) 2021 Nordix Foundation. * ================================================================================ * Licensed under the Apache License, Version 2.0 (the "License"); * you may not use this file except in compliance with the License. * You may obtain a copy of the License at * http://www.apache.org/licenses/LICENSE-2.0 * * Unless required by applicable law or agreed to in writing, software * distributed under the License is distributed on an "AS IS" BASIS, *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. * See the License for the specific language governing permissions and * limitations under the License. * ============LICENSE_END========================================================= * * *******************************************************************************/ package org.onap.dmaap.kafkaAuthorize; import java.nio.charset.StandardCharsets; import java.util.ArrayList; import java.util.Arrays; import java.util.List; import java.util.Map; import javax.security.auth.callback.CallbackHandler; import javax.security.sasl.Sasl; import javax.security.sasl.SaslException; import javax.security.sasl.SaslServer; import javax.security.sasl.SaslServerFactory; import org.apache.kafka.common.errors.SaslAuthenticationException; import org.onap.dmaap.commonauth.kafka.base.authorization.AuthorizationProviderFactory; /** * Simple SaslServer implementation for SASL/PLAIN. In order to make this * implementation fully pluggable, authentication of username/password is fully * contained within the server implementation. *

* Valid users with passwords are specified in the Jaas configuration file. Each * user is specified with user_ as key and as value. This * is consistent with Zookeeper Digest-MD5 implementation. *

* To avoid storing clear passwords on disk or to integrate with external * authentication servers in production systems, this module can be replaced * with a different implementation. * */ public class PlainSaslServer1 implements SaslServer { public static final String PLAIN_MECHANISM = "PLAIN"; private boolean complete; private String authorizationId; private static final String AUTH_EXC_NOT_COMPLETE = "Authentication exchange has not completed"; /** * @throws SaslAuthenticationException if username/password combination is invalid or if the requested * authorization id is not the same as username. *

* Note: This method may throw {@link SaslAuthenticationException} to provide custom error messages * to clients. But care should be taken to avoid including any information in the exception message that * should not be leaked to unauthenticated clients. It may be safer to throw {@link SaslException} in * some cases so that a standard error message is returned to clients. *

*/ @Override public byte[] evaluateResponse(byte[] responseBytes) throws SaslAuthenticationException { /* * Message format (from https://tools.ietf.org/html/rfc4616): * * message = [authzid] UTF8NUL authcid UTF8NUL passwd * authcid = 1*SAFE ; MUST accept up to 255 octets * authzid = 1*SAFE ; MUST accept up to 255 octets * passwd = 1*SAFE ; MUST accept up to 255 octets * UTF8NUL = %x00 ; UTF-8 encoded NUL character * * SAFE = UTF1 / UTF2 / UTF3 / UTF4 * ;; any UTF-8 encoded Unicode character except NUL */ String response = new String(responseBytes, StandardCharsets.UTF_8); List tokens = extractTokens(response); String authorizationIdFromClient = tokens.get(0); String username = tokens.get(1); String password = tokens.get(2); if (username.isEmpty()) { throw new SaslAuthenticationException("Authentication failed: username not specified"); } if (password.isEmpty()) { throw new SaslAuthenticationException("Authentication failed: password not specified"); } String aafResponse = "Not Verified"; try { aafResponse = AuthorizationProviderFactory.getProviderFactory().getProvider().authenticate(username, password); } catch (Exception ignored) { throw new SaslAuthenticationException("Authentication failed: " + aafResponse + " User " + username); } if (null != aafResponse) { throw new SaslAuthenticationException("Authentication failed: " + aafResponse + " User " + username); } if (!authorizationIdFromClient.isEmpty() && !authorizationIdFromClient.equals(username)) throw new SaslAuthenticationException("Authentication failed: Client requested an authorization id that is different from username"); this.authorizationId = username; complete = true; return new byte[0]; } private List extractTokens(String string) { List tokens = new ArrayList<>(); int startIndex = 0; for (int i = 0; i < 4; ++i) { int endIndex = string.indexOf("\u0000", startIndex); if (endIndex == -1) { tokens.add(string.substring(startIndex)); break; } tokens.add(string.substring(startIndex, endIndex)); startIndex = endIndex + 1; } if (tokens.size() != 3) throw new SaslAuthenticationException("Invalid SASL/PLAIN response: expected 3 tokens, got " + tokens.size()); return tokens; } @Override public String getAuthorizationID() { if (!complete) throw new IllegalStateException(AUTH_EXC_NOT_COMPLETE); return authorizationId; } @Override public String getMechanismName() { return PLAIN_MECHANISM; } @Override public Object getNegotiatedProperty(String propName) { if (!complete) throw new IllegalStateException(AUTH_EXC_NOT_COMPLETE); return null; } @Override public boolean isComplete() { return complete; } @Override public byte[] unwrap(byte[] incoming, int offset, int len) { if (!complete) throw new IllegalStateException(AUTH_EXC_NOT_COMPLETE); return Arrays.copyOfRange(incoming, offset, offset + len); } @Override public byte[] wrap(byte[] outgoing, int offset, int len) { if (!complete) throw new IllegalStateException(AUTH_EXC_NOT_COMPLETE); return Arrays.copyOfRange(outgoing, offset, offset + len); } @Override public void dispose() { // TODO Auto-generate method stub } public static class PlainSaslServerFactory1 implements SaslServerFactory { @Override public SaslServer createSaslServer(String mechanism, String protocol, String serverName, Map props, CallbackHandler cbh) throws SaslException { if (!PLAIN_MECHANISM.equals(mechanism)) throw new SaslException(String.format("Mechanism '%s' is not supported. Only PLAIN is supported.", mechanism)); return new PlainSaslServer1(); } @Override public String[] getMechanismNames(Map props) { if (props == null) return new String[]{PLAIN_MECHANISM}; String noPlainText = (String) props.get(Sasl.POLICY_NOPLAINTEXT); if ("true".equals(noPlainText)) return new String[]{}; else return new String[]{PLAIN_MECHANISM}; } } }
